Vision of Universitas Trisakti 

To become a reliable university with international standards, while maintaining local values in developing science, technology, arts, and culture to improve quality of life and civilization.

Mission of Universitas Trisakti

  1. To enhance Universitas Trisakti’s role in producing human resources with intellectual capabilities, international standards, and the Trikrama Trisakti character through education and teaching activities.

  2. To improve research activities aimed at developing science, technology, and arts based on local values to address national issues and enhance the quality of life and civilization.

  3. To increase Universitas Trisakti’s role in supporting the needs of society and industry through community service activities.

  4. To strengthen Universitas Trisakti’s commitment to upholding good university governance.

Universitas Trisakti Emblem

The emblem of the University and the Faculty colors at Universitas Trisakti are as stipulated in Article 8 of the Universitas Trisakti Statute of 2023, which are:

  1. The University emblem is black and consists of a Trident symbolizing the Tridharma of Higher Education, standing on five roots representing the Pancasila principle.
  2. Faculty emblems follow the same shape and color as the Universitas Trisakti emblem.
  3. Faculty colors follow the respective Faculty’s colors.

 

       

Details/Explanation:

  1. The emblem uses black for the Trident image and the text “UNIVERSITAS TRISAKTI,” which is unified as one.
  2. The proportion ratio of width to height is seven (7) to six (6).
  3. The name “UNIVERSITAS TRISAKTI” is written in Indonesian using Arial font and in uppercase letters. It is not translated into other languages.
  4. The text “UNIVERSITAS TRISAKTI” is placed below the emblem and aligned with the Trident image, with the text width matching the width of the Trident image.
  5. The distance between the Trident image and the text “UNIVERSITAS TRISAKTI” should be equal to the height of the text.
